What happened

Liverpool have opened talks with AS Monaco over a potential transfer for Maghnes Akliouche, a 22-year-old French winger who has emerged as one of Ligue 1's most promising attacking talents. PSG are also said to be monitoring the situation, creating a potential bidding war. Akliouche, who primarily operates from the right wing, has impressed in Ligue 1 with his dribbling and creativity. No fee or personal terms have been discussed yet, with Liverpool's approach described as preliminary.

Chance analysis

Akliouche is a young, technically gifted winger who would add depth and creativity to Liverpool's attacking options. Competition from PSG could drive up the price, and Monaco are under no pressure to sell. If Liverpool can secure Akliouche, he would likely serve as rotation and long-term succession for their wide attacking positions, fitting the profile of player sporting director Richard Hughes has targeted.
